wordpress移除不必要的信息

1.移除不必要的头部信息

//移除不必要head信息
remove_action('wp_head', 'wp_generator' ); //去除版本信息
remove_action('wp_head', 'wlwmanifest_link' );
remove_action('wp_head', 'rsd_link' );//清除离线编辑器接口
remove_action('wp_head', 'adjacent_posts_rel_link_wp_head', 10, 0 );//清除前后文信息
remove_action('wp_head', 'feed_links',2 );
remove_action('wp_head', 'feed_links_extra',3 );//清除feed信息
remove_action('wp_head', 'wp_shortlink_wp_head',10,0 );

2.清除DashBoard小工具

 1 //清除dashboard小插件
 2 function remove_dashboard_widgets() {
 3     // Globalize the metaboxes array, this holds all the widgets for wp-admin
 4     global $wp_meta_boxes;
 5     // 以下这一行代码将删除 "快速发布" 模块
 6      unset($wp_meta_boxes['dashboard']['side']['core']['dashboard_quick_press']);
 7     // 以下这一行代码将删除 "引入链接" 模块
 8      unset($wp_meta_boxes['dashboard']['normal']['core']['dashboard_incoming_links']);
 9     // 以下这一行代码将删除 "插件" 模块
10      unset($wp_meta_boxes['dashboard']['normal']['core']['dashboard_plugins']);
11     // 以下这一行代码将删除 "近期评论" 模块
12      unset($wp_meta_boxes['dashboard']['normal']['core']['dashboard_recent_comments']);
13     // 以下这一行代码将删除 "近期草稿" 模块
14      unset($wp_meta_boxes['dashboard']['side']['core']['dashboard_recent_drafts']);
15     // 以下这一行代码将删除 "WordPress 开发日志" 模块
16     unset($wp_meta_boxes['dashboard']['side']['core']['dashboard_primary']);
17     // 以下这一行代码将删除 "其它 WordPress 新闻" 模块
18      unset($wp_meta_boxes['dashboard']['side']['core']['dashboard_secondary']);
19     // 以下这一行代码将删除 "概况" 模块
20      unset($wp_meta_boxes['dashboard']['normal']['core']['dashboard_right_now']);
21 }
22 add_action('wp_dashboard_setup', 'remove_dashboard_widgets' );

3.禁止wordpress显示更新信息

 1 //禁用更新提示
 2 add_filter('pre_site_transient_update_core',    create_function('$a', "return null;")); // 关闭核心提示
 3 
 4 add_filter('pre_site_transient_update_plugins', create_function('$a', "return null;")); // 关闭插件提示
 5 
 6 add_filter('pre_site_transient_update_themes',  create_function('$a', "return null;")); // 关闭主题提示
 7 
 8 remove_action('admin_init', '_maybe_update_core');    // 禁止 WordPress 检查更新
 9 
10 remove_action('admin_init', '_maybe_update_plugins'); // 禁止 WordPress 更新插件
11 
12 remove_action('admin_init', '_maybe_update_themes');  // 禁止 WordPress 更新主题

4.屏蔽后台页脚信息

1 //屏蔽后台页脚信息
2 function change_footer_admin () {return '';}
3 add_filter('admin_footer_text', 'change_footer_admin', 9999);
4 function change_footer_version() {return '';}
5 add_filter( 'update_footer', 'change_footer_version', 9999);

5.屏蔽左上logo

1 //屏蔽左上logo
2 function annointed_admin_bar_remove() {
3         global $wp_admin_bar;
4         /* Remove their stuff */
5         $wp_admin_bar->remove_menu('wp-logo');
6 }
7 add_action('wp_before_admin_bar_render', 'annointed_admin_bar_remove', 0);

转载于:https://www.cnblogs.com/mansu/p/4770415.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值